> MeeGo combines Intel’s Moblin and Nokia’s Maemo projects at the Linux
> Foundation to create one open source uber-platform for the next
> generation of computing devices: tablets, pocketable computers,
> netbooks, automotive IVI and more.
>
> Why should you pay attention to this announcement? With MeeGo you have
> the world’s largest chip manufacturer and the world’s largest mobile
> handset manufacturer joining forces to create an incredible opportunity
> for developers who want to reach millions of users with innovative
> technology.
